New Homebuyer Advice & Secrets
Embarking on the journey of buying your new home can feel challenging, but with smart planning, it's absolutely realistic. Below are some crucial advice for potential homeowners. Begin by thoroughly assessing your budgetary situation - evaluate your credit score and calculate how much you can comfortably borrow. Avoid stretching your budget too thinly. Next, obtain preliminary approval for a home finance - this demonstrates vendors you're a serious customer. Note to include various expenses, including initial payments, settlement charges, and ongoing property ownership payments. Finally, hire a experienced housing representative who can guide you through the complete purchase.

Understanding Property Taxes and Assessments
Property levies can feel like a confusing expense for homeowners. Simply put , they’re payments made to local jurisdictions to fund local services like education and streets. Your assessment is typically based on the determined value of your home, although rates can vary significantly based on your location and local policies . Furthermore , separate assessments may appear on your bill for specific projects , such as road repairs, that directly benefit your district. Consequently , it's crucial to grasp how these charges are calculated and how they support your city .
